Video: 2025 Mercedes-AMG C 63 gets V8 engine conversion

Mercedes-AMG’s latest C 63 S E Performance has left plenty of car enthusiasts wanting. Despite its prodigious combined outputs of 500kW and 1020Nm – which gives it the ability to catapult from 0-100km/h in 3.4 seconds, its hybrid powertrain makes it extremely heavy at 2186kg and its four-cylinder combustion engine does not create the rumble befitting a car of that stature.

This would explain why Mercedes-AMG is switching back to a V8 powertrain for some models, as reported. In the meantime, VUK Automobile has ripped out the hybrid hardware and given the 2025 W206 C 63 S the V8 powertrain it always deserved. In the process, it has shed a whopping 500kg.

2025 Mercedes-AMG C63S V8 conversion - engine

Featured by Azizdrives on YouTube, the result is a very cohesive and factory-feeling car, with the grin and laughter from the YouTuber underscoring this.

If this isn’t bonkers enough, a version with over 800hp is on the cards, with a V12-swapped version of the latest G-Class also featured in the video.
